The Role

  • Quality of assigned deliverables.
  • Compliance of the projects’ engineering deliverables with specified requirements, codes, standards, and procedures (including quality and security).
  • Ensuring all customer technical requirements are attained.
  • Technical integrity and development of safe, legally compliant engineering solutions verifying and validating that they satisfy the project requirements.
  • Collate, document and review requirements from works information and disseminate these requirements clearly to the parties that will contribute to the solution.
  • Planning and executing engineering and design activities. Ensuring projects are delivered within approved budgets and scheduled completion dates.
  • Production of design quality plans and ensuring work is undertaken in accordance with relevant quality arrangements.
  • Collaboration with the Project Manager in the generation and maintenance of detailed project plans and deliverable schedules.
  • Identifies resource requirements and requests resources as required.
  • Reporting progress of engineering deliverables against specified work plans.
  • Source ideas and innovation from multiple sources and proactively generate value adding options to achieve the optimum engineered solution.
  • Identify applicable legislation and ensure compliance.
  • Production of engineering documentation to influence and provide evidence of the design process.
  • Develop technical specifications that define the totality of requirements for engineering solutions.
  • Assess the specific elements that contribute to the equipment design and document justification / arguments which substantiate it.
  • Production of detailed calculations to establish sizing, specification, or rating of components.
  • Conduct risk assessments, identify, evaluate and mitigate hazards by design. o Ensure configuration of baseline of deliverables is accurately maintained.
  • Ensure work under their supervision is consistent in the use of software tools, deliverable protocols, formats, templates, numbering, and storage.
  • Support the production of technical information in tenders.
  • Be the key point of contact with customer stakeholders and build collaborative relationships.
  • Identifying the requirements for, and organising and undertaking of design reviews.

The Person

  • Degree with honours or level 6 equivalent (Ideally)
  • Chartered Engineer or equivalent.
  • Several years’ experience working in design engineering.
  • A number of years’ experience working within a highly regulated industry (e.g. Nuclear)
  • Proficient in the use of standard Microsoft Office software such as Word / Excel.
  • Competent in the use CAD software / digital tools. Understands and can apply the company management system.
  • Understands and can apply design codes, standards, and procedures.
  • Understands and can apply law (Acts and Regulations), codes of practice and designated standards appropriate to scope of work.
  • Breadth of demonstrable experience of design and detailing (appropriate to discipline) of plant and equipment.
  • Understands the NEC suite of contracts, change control methodology and common project management practices.
  • Breadth of experience of respective discipline (e.g. Mechanical or Electrical). Demonstrable capability of supervision for a small team of engineers and designers (up to 15 but frequently less) in the definition, implementation, and delivery of engineering work packages.
  • Commercial understanding, budgeting & cost control, reporting practices.
  • Prepare and maintain schedules for activities and events, taking account of dependencies and resource requirements.
  • Provide leadership within an engineering department and act as a custodian of resource and expertise.
